DESCRIPTION Luscombe Maye is delighted to bring to market West Barn, a beautifully converted semi-detached stone barn set within an attractive courtyard. The property combines character features with modern living and offers spacious, well-balanced accommodation over two floors. The property is arranged in a reverse-level layout to maximise light and living space. On the ground floor, there are three well-proportioned double bedrooms, including a principal bedroom with its own ensuite shower room and built-in storage. A contemporary family bathroom serves the remaining bedrooms, along with additional storage areas. A staircase leads to the first-floor living space, which extends to over 40 feet in length. This open-plan kitchen, dining and living area features a vaulted ceiling with exposed beams and trusses, with large windows and roof lights providing plenty of natural light. A modern fitted kitchen is positioned at one end, with ample space for dining and seating. The property retains many original features, including exposed timbers, while benefiting from double glazing and oil-fired central heating. Externally, the property offers two allocated parking spaces, a courtyard seating area, covered storage/car port and an additional outside store. Located within the curtilage of a Grade II Listed building, the property is subject to associated conditions. DIRECTIONS what3words location ///defender.offshore.mango SOUTH BRENT The moorland village of South Brent stands in the valley of the River Avon under the southern foothills of Dartmoor National Park and on the northern edge of the lovely South Hams, fifteen miles from the centre of Plymouth. The village is one with a strong community with three churches, one of which dates back to Norman times, a primary school and a wide variety of shops. There are well-regarded community colleges at Totnes and Ivybridge, approximately eight and five miles distant respectively, and both towns offer a comprehensive range of facilities for the wider community. Some of the finest beaches on the south coast, along with the South West Coast Path, are all within easy reach. Situated just off the A38 Expressway, the village is well placed for quick access to Plymouth, Torbay and Exeter for which there are regular bus services. Rail services can be found at Ivybridge, approximately five miles distant, offering services to Plymouth, Totnes, Newton Abbot, Exeter St David's and on to Bristol, Cardiff and London.
